The Tragic Incident

According to Kentucky State Police, the incident occurred on Monday at a home located on Coal Road in Jackson County. Initial reports indicate that the 7-year-old child unintentionally discharged a firearm, resulting in the tragic shooting of the 5-year-old child. Despite immediate attempts to administer life-saving measures, the child succumbed to their injuries and was pronounced dead at the scene by the coroner.

Addressing Firearm Safety

This unfortunate incident serves as a reminder of the importance of responsible firearm ownership and storage, particularly in households with children. According to the advocacy group Everytown for Gun Safety, firearms are the leading cause of death among children and teenagers in the United States. Each year, thousands of children and teens are either killed or injured by firearms, with millions more exposed to the traumatic effects of gun violence.

Ensuring the safety of children requires a multifaceted approach involving education, awareness, and proper storage of firearms. It is crucial for parents and guardians to secure firearms in a manner that prevents access by unauthorized individuals, especially children. Additionally, promoting responsible gun ownership, such as participating in firearm safety courses and adhering to local regulations, can significantly contribute to preventing such tragic incidents.
